Default Water leak in Jack location.

Hi all, I have 2014 Jeep JK 2 door, and the well where Jack is located keeps filling up with water, I thought it may be plug seal, so I replaced plug and silicon in, and that did not work. No idea where water is coming from but it rust out my jack to the point it doesn't work, Wonder is anyone had same problem and can offer some assistance. Thank you.

Std jack you will be throwing it out once you get into lifting ur Jeep as you will be in the market for a HIGH LIFT ($100)
To the water problem it could be coming from check drivers side or pass (not sure where the JK jack is placed) floor and
firewall, the drain from the vent outside below windshield may be plugged with debris
